What is the slope-intercept form of a linear equation?

Back

The slope-intercept form is y = mx + b, where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ept.

What does the slope of a line represent in a real-world context?

Back

The slope represents the rate of change or how much y changes for a unit change in x.

What does the y-intercept represent in a linear equation?

Back

The y-intercept represents the value of y when x is 0, often interpreted as the starting value in real-world problems.

How do you calculate the slope between two points (x1, y1) and (x2, y2)?

Back

The slope (m) is calculated using the formula m = (y2 - y1) / (x2 - x1).
